Robin Trower: Coming Closer to the Day

Read "Coming Closer to the Day" reviewed by Doug Collette


Upon departing Procol Harum in the early Seventies, guitarist Robin Trower embarked upon a solo career in which he has proved himself both prolific and consistent (like the imagistic cover art of the albums). Completely absorbing by its finish, Coming Closer to the Day reaffirms those virtues and belies the intimations of mortality in its title. The blues-drenched, semi-psychedelic guitar tones on the opening “Diving Bell" certainly augur well for the twenty-third studio entry in the Trower discography. ...

Robin Trower: New Album and U.S. Tour

Robin Trower: New Album and U.S. Tour

Source: JamBase

TOUR STARTS JANUARY 27 IN FT. LAUDERDALE Robin Trower returns to the US in 2011 for an extensive tour in support of his new CD The Playful Heart. Starting in Fort Lauderdale Florida on January 27, and continuing through the end of June, Robin will be performing his signature songs, with a variety of new material and some surprises included in the set.
